Use the Water Taxi to “Sailgate” from West Seattle to the game

Join the party from West Seattle using the King County Water Taxi to get to the game and then take it home after the victory (fingers crossed).
Walk, roll or scoot from Pier 50 to the stadium. After the game, there will be special post-game sailings from Pier 50 to the Seacrest Dock at 8:00 p.m., 8:45 p.m. and 9:30 p.m. Then you can take the free shuttle from Seacrest to the West Seattle Junction (Route 773) or ride along Alki (Route 775)
And don’t forget, if you want to take your time to celebrate (or commiserate) you can get back to West Seattle by strolling to Alaskan Way South at South Jackson Street and riding the RapidRide C or H lines.

If you’re coming north or south, Metro and Sound Transit’s Link light rail are a combo equal to Sam Darnold to JSN! We have buses that’ll take you to 1 Line stations — which now runs between Lynnwood, downtown Seattle and Federal Way.
Coming over from the Eastside? In partnership with Sound Transit, there are three routes (Sound Transit Express Routes 545, 550 and 554) that will provide additional post-game service to the Eastside.
